When the hefty walleyes carry on to the big-water shoals in the late summertime, attempt going after them with a bucktail jig and a 1-inch pinch of nightcrawler. The bait covers the hook point, deflects weeds, and supplies a taste of prey. With nothing dangling or waving, it stays protected no matter of present, casts, or ambitious panfish.


Whether you're wading or angling from a boat, drifting worms is one of the fantastic searching approaches for larger rivers. For trout, a spade-dug, 4-inch garden worm is the best size; for bass, walleyes, and steelhead, a nightcrawler might be a far better choice. The secret is to drift the lure through feeding and holding areas since fish in present are not mosting likely to ferret out the bait, as they could in still water.


Fish the transitions: mouths of tributaries, bank-side slicks, and the sides of huge pools. His dictum uses to any number of angling maneuvers, consisting of the matter of including a piece of worm to a wet fly.

Here's how to keep a worm box: Cut a sheet of CDX-grade plywood, which is made with waterproof adhesives, to your dimensions. Toenail it with each other and pierce a loads 12-inch openings in the base for drainage


Top Guidelines Of Where To Find Red Wigglers


Fill it with shredded paper, leaves, peat moss, and dirt. Moisten lightly. Cover and let rest for a week. Include a few hundred worms and feed them 2 times a week. Maintain the bed linen moist yet not wet. On the food selection: lettuce, fruit and vegetable waste, and the occasional nongreasy leftover.




Much like veggie scraps, you can take your used coffee grounds and include them to a worm box. Worms enjoy consuming coffee premises. With the appropriate conditions and damp, healthy soil, worms can stay in a bucket of dust for around three weeks. Shop out of direct sunlight and maintain a temperature level in between 50 and 80 levels.

Ordering bulk red worms calls for prep work for an effective vermicomposting experience. Prior to you order, established a great setting for your worms. This implies producing a worm bin and preparing the appropriate bedding for your worms.


You can pick from a continual circulation bin, a stackable bin, or also a do it yourself container. Make certain it has great drainage and aeration for your worms' wellness. Your worm container must blend "eco-friendly" and "brown" materials. The carbon-to-nitrogen ratio should have to do with 20:1. Add food scraps and dry bed linen to produce a nutrient-rich environment for your worms.


Some Known Details About Where To Find Red Wigglers


One large error is overfeeding, causing fruit flies and negative scents. navigate here Red wigglers should eat 1-2 times a week. Wait till 80% of the last food is preceded including extra. Not offering worms the ideal care is an additional important link mistake. This consists of maintaining the ideal temperature level and dampness. Worms consume less when it's too cold or as well warm.

Vermi-composting is the process of composting using earthworms. The procedure operates best when red worms, additionally referred to as "red wigglers", are used to refine the waste products. Night crawlers are not great worms for vermi-composting. Vermi-composting is typically much faster, more complete, develops a rich visit homepage organic product and offers an excellent supply of worms for angling.

Build your own worm container. The general rule for the size of the container is one square foot of area per pound of waste food. Purchase a solid or opaque colored plastic container that is rectangular in shape and concerning 12 to 15 inches detailed. The container needs to have a top.


Holes in the sides of the container should start around four inches from the base of the container. Openings pierced in the bottom of the container can aid with drain.
